South African women toured Bangladesh in January 2017. [1] The tour consisted of a series of five Women's One Day Internationals (WODIs). [2] South African women were previously scheduled to tour Bangladesh in October 2015 to play three WODIs and four Women's Twenty20 Internationals (WT20Is), but the tour was abandoned with no official statement from either BCB or CSA.
South Africa women won the series 4–1. [3]
